Origin and Meaning
The surname Espalza has its origins in the Basque region of Spain. The name is believed to be derived from the Basque word "espalka," which means slope or decline. This could suggest that the name was originally given to someone who lived on or near a sloping piece of land.
Spread and Incidence
Colombia (147 incidences)
In Colombia, Espalza is a relatively common surname, with 147 incidences reported. This could be due to historical migration patterns or the presence of Basque settlers in the country.
Venezuela (29 incidences)
In Venezuela, Espalza is a less common surname, with only 29 reported incidences. The lower incidence rate could be attributed to the smaller Basque population in the country compared to other regions.
United States (4 incidences)
In the United States, Espalza is a rare surname, with only four reported incidences. This could be a result of limited migration from Basque regions to the US or a smaller Basque community in the country.
Argentina (1 incidence)
In Argentina, Espalza is an extremely rare surname, with only one reported incidence. This could be due to limited migration from Basque regions to Argentina or minimal presence of Basque settlers in the country.
